NetDXCluster provides amateur (ham) radio operators access to AR DX Cluster nodes using telnet via the Internet. An Internet connection is required. This software merely works under Mac OS X 10.1.3 or later. It also requires the BSD subsystem that is typically installed when installing OSX. If the BSD subsystem option was not installed, you will probably receive a quickly failure on starting it up. NetDXCluster works by launching Telnet in a eggshell and letting that do the networking. |
